The Emperor is this understated gem that dives deep into the human experience, presented through a simple yet profound setup. The film unfolds in a stark motel, where three characters—each carrying significant emotional baggage—share their stories, reflecting on life and impending death. The pacing is deliberate, allowing space for introspection, almost like a stage play with its confined setting. The performances are raw, capturing both vulnerability and strength, resonating with anyone who's grappled with their past. The contrast between the grim atmosphere and the introspective storytelling adds a unique flavor to the drama. It’s not flashy, but it’s this subtlety that makes it memorable in its own right.
